Father Abraham

  • July 29th, 2009
  • Posted in Blast Off!

Father Abraham, an underground rapper and producer from Boston, has undertaken the ambitious project of creating a track a week for a year, the sort of thing you wish all bands would do but few have the work ethic to actually pull off.
